The contact owns a 2019 GMC Sierra 1500. The contact stated that the wheels on the vehicle were not what was listed in the description of the vehicle. The vehicles installed on the vehicle were 17-inch wheels instead of the 18-inch wheels listed as the original equipment for the vehicle. The contact was concerned that the difference between the OEM wheels and the wheels installed on the vehicle could cause ABS failures while driving the vehicle. The contact referenced NHTSA ID Number: 21V985000 (TIRES), but the VIN was not included in the recall. The dealer was not notified of the issue. The vehicle was not repaired.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The failure mileage was 44,741.

The contact owns a 2019 GMC Sierra 1500. While driving approximately 5 mph, a "terrible noise" was heard. The rear driveshaft assembly connected to the differential came apart. The vehicle was taken to barker Buick GMC (985-464-8194, located at 6444 w main St, houma, la 70360) where the rim, flange, and the wheel were replaced. The manufacturer was made aware of the failure and stated that the dealer performed the correct repairs. The failure mileage was approximately 10,400. Contacted GM customer assistence in and in conclusion said that the part was not defective and closed my complaint case no. 9-5277582246
